WebA charging order is a court order which imposes a charge on the freehold or leasehold property of a debtor in order to secure payment of a debt. The charge is registered with the Land Registry. If the court grants a charging order the unsecured debt becomes secured. This means the debt is converted from a non-priority debt into a priority debt ...
